How to calculate allele frequency.

Respuesta :

aneleziq076
aneleziq076 aneleziq076
  • 01-12-2021

Answer:

by dividing the number of times the allele of interest is observed in a population by the total number of copies of all the alleles at that particular genetic locus in the population
